Michele Y. Morris is a scholar working on Oceanography, Atmospheric Science and Global and Planetary Change. According to data from OpenAlex, Michele Y. Morris has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 445 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Oceanography, 7 papers in Atmospheric Science and 5 papers in Global and Planetary Change. Recurrent topics in Michele Y. Morris’s work include Oceanographic and Atmospheric Processes (11 papers), Climate variability and models (5 papers) and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(4 papers). Michele Y. Morris is often cited by papers focused on Oceanographic and Atmospheric Processes (11 papers), Climate variability and models (5 papers) and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(4 papers). Michele Y. Morris collaborates with scholars based in New Zealand, United States and Canada. Michele Y. Morris's co-authors include Helen L Neil, Basil R. Stanton, Dean Roemmich, Lionel Carter, J. R. Donguy, W. R. Young, Bruce D. Cornuelle, Louis C. St. Laurent, Nelson G. Hogg and Melinda M. Hall and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res, Journal of Physical Oceanography and New Zealand Journal of Marine and Freshwater Research.
